General Comments

There are zillions of high-end cables to choose from today but most of them are simply repackaged OEM wire or of gimmicky construction. Many brands use cheap connectors like the $2 Neutrik XLRs even found on multi-thousand dollar cables. It seems like many prefer the cheap Eichmann plastic RCA plugs. Add to this the large diameter cable jackets housing 22 gauge wire (way too much plastic).

The Translucent Audio cables are a refreshing departure from the many cable clones available. The RCA interconnects sport the world's best connectors (also expensive) Xhadow plugs. These plugs are the real deal made from copper (not brass) stock. They are silver plated with anodized barrels, absolutely stunning! The cable itself is about .250 inch and flexible. It has a nice finely woven gray jacket. The wire is a silver/copper alloy done in OCC, six nines purity.

The sound, or lack thereof of these cables is excellent. Not bright or dark. Very well balanced from A-Z. Nicely focused sound-stage with lots of depth. Their hallmark appears to be in information retrieval. I am hearing more detail than my old cables offered. The small diameter cables and good fitting connectors make them a breeze to install in my crowded equipment rack.

The Transparent Audio cables are in a class of their own. When you factor-in the connectors, build quality, superb sonics, AND the price, there is no equal. These cables bested my stable of multi-thousand dollar brands and all of my sub one thousand dollar cables. They are easy to buy and you get to try for 30-days in your rig. Highly recommended!
